    • Some team stats through 8 games

      3rd in points per game in Conference- 22nd national

      2nd in shooting % in conference- 5th national

      tied for 1st in 3pt %, really improved that # lately- 17th nationally

      worst FT shooting team in the conference- believe there are only 11 teams worse in all of D-1. Yikes

      3rd in the conference in rebounding- 61st nationally

      2nd in assists per game conference- 16th nationally

      Surprisingly 3rd in Blocks in conference- 34th nationally playing mostly 4 guard lineup…

      KenPom has us 8th nationally in Adjusted Offense, 6th in Adjust Defense.

      So far so good.

    • RE: The portal.

      @drgnslayr

      I’ve seen that some Donors might have some buyers fatigue after the past couple NIL driven portal cycles. There hasn’t been a great return on investment, just look at the Storr fiasco. Hard to keep getting them to buy-in by giving more and more when the results don’t match the price.

      They definitely found some sticker shock this offseason with some of the early portal guys they targeted, and it sounds like they weren’t willing to bite on being the highest bidder in some of those either.

      There’s also some risks in play with having Peterson. You can’t pay guys that were looking for 2+ mil and not expect Peterson’s camp to up the price he’s getting as the crown jewel of the team. Peterson and Flory are going to account for 50% or more of the pool of funds.

      I think you hit the nail on the head on other contributing factors- GM, Football stadium. The lack of success in Football over the years does have an impact ($ wise), the Big-12 for football took a big nose-dive in reputation losing Texas and OU as well. Vaughn being added to the staff was partly, if not driven by donors wish for changes. There’s potentially more changes still coming.

      I also think there’s some negative recruiting going on against KU when it comes to Portal guys (lack of success this past year) and with Self at the end of his career.

      It’s really an adapt or die atmosphere right now. They are still adapting it looks
